Based on the organophosphorus pesticides have a strong catalytic function on oxidization of hydrogen peroxide and benzidine, one study investigating of dichlorvos was perforemed. With the Triton X-114 as extractant, the characteristics of the cloud point extraction system in dichlorvos determination was studied. In pH 8.5 ammonia buffer solution, a stable yellow complex was formed in the reaction of catalytic of dichlorvos on hydrogen peroxide and benzidine. This complex was determined by cloud point extraction. The maximum absorption wave length is 425 nm. In the range of 0 μg ~ 250 μg, the linear relationship of the absorbance values is good. The relation coefficient is 0.999 8. The molar absorbance coefficient is 5.3×104 L·mol-1·cm-1. The method detection limit of 22.2 μg/L was measured. On determination for dichlorvos in five kinds of vegetables, the average spiked recoveries were 82.3% ~ 102%, RSD ≤ 8.9%. |
